在当今数字化的世界中,区块链技术以其去中心化和安全性受到广泛关注。微信作为国内最大的社交媒体和支付平台,结合区块链技术,可以为用户提供更安全和高效的钱包服务。本篇文章将详细介绍如何开发一个微信区块链钱包,包括技术架构、功能设计、安全性考虑、用户体验等多个方面。
区块链钱包是一种用于存储、管理和交易数字货币(如比特币、以太坊等)的应用程序。它允许用户创建和管理他们的公私钥,从而安全地发送与接收数字资产。区块链钱包的类型主要包括热钱包和冷钱包,前者在线并便于使用,后者离线更为安全。
微信拥有庞大的用户基数和完善的社交网络,利用其平台开发区块链钱包能够快速吸引用户。用户在日常使用微信的过程中,可以轻松接入区块链钱包,享受更为便捷的数字资产管理。)
开发微信区块链钱包的流程可以分为以下几个步骤:
微信区块链钱包的核心功能应包括:
在开发过程中,安全性是关键。在设计微信区块链钱包时,需要考虑以下几个方面:
用户体验是钱包成功与否的关键。以下是一些建议:
选择合适的区块链技术是开发微信区块链钱包的关键。首先,需要根据目标市场和用户需求进行选择。如果你想要支持高频交易,可能选择速度更快的区块链,如以太坊。其次,考虑技术的成熟性和社区支持,可以选择比特币或以太坊等主流公链。最后,还需评估区块链的扩展性,以适应未来可能的增长需求。
钱包的安全性是用户最关心的问题之一。可以通过多种方式增强安全性,例如使用冷存储方式,确保私钥存储在离线环境中。其次,实施多重身份验证措施,用户在进行重要操作时需提供额外的信息。还可以利用智能合约技术,在交易发布前进行多方确认。此外,确保钱包代码经过充分审计,以发现潜在的安全漏洞也是非常重要的。
提升用户体验需要从多个方面入手,首先是用户界面的设计。界面应该,用户可以很方便地找到自己需要的功能。其次,交易流程,尽量减少用户在发送和接收数字资产时的操作步骤。此外,提供实时的交易状态更新,让用户随时了解交易进程。其中,根据用户使用习惯提供个性化推荐和提醒也可以显著提升用户体验。
钱包上线后,需要进行有效的市场推广。可以通过实现和微信相关的各种社交活动,吸引用户关注。社交媒体广告、流量引导到官方网站以及社区营销都是有效的方法。此外,通过优质的内容营销,提高钱包在搜索引擎中的排名,增加曝光率也非常重要。同时,根据用户反馈不断改进功能,留住用户,推动二次传播。
总结而言,开发一个高效安全的微信区块链钱包是一个复杂而又充满挑战的过程。在这个过程中,不仅要关注技术实现和安全性,更应考虑用户体验和市场推广。希望本文的内容能为想要进入区块链钱包开发领域的开发者提供一些实用的参考。
leave a reply